Playwright, screenwriter and director Kenneth Lonergan will begin filming his follow-up to the critically acclaimed movie "You Can Count on Me" in New York City in September.

The feature, titled "Margaret," will star Lonergan's wife, actress J. Smith Cameron, and Matthew Broderick in a small role. "If he does well in that part, I may consider him for something bigger later," Lonergan joked to Playbill.com columnist Harry Haun.
Lonergan added that the September start time was not yet firm, and the film still had to be fully cast. Both Broderick and Smith-Cameron acted in "You Can Count on Me," which starred Laura Linney and Mark Ruffalo as two very different grown siblings briefly dwelling together in the house they grew up in. The film was Lonergan's directorial debut.
Lonergan's stage plays include The Waverly Gallery, Lobby Hero and This Is Our Youth.
